1. Understanding Hugo Academic
Hugo Academic (now Hugo Blox) is a static site generator specifically designed for academics and researchers.
What is a Static Site Generator?
- Converts Markdown files → HTML websites
- No database needed
- Fast loading, easy hosting
- Perfect for academic portfolios
Key Advantages:
- ✅ Professional academic design
- ✅ Publication management
- ✅ CV/Resume integration
- ✅ Research project showcase
- ✅ Active community support
2. Deployment Platform: Why Netlify
The Critical Decision
| Platform | Setup Time | Difficulty | Recommendation |
|---|---|---|---|
| Netlify | 10 minutes | ⭐ Easy | 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 |
| GitHub Pages | 2-8 hours | ⭐⭐⭐ Hard | ⭐⭐ |
My Experience:
Initial attempt: GitHub Pages
↓
Encountered TailwindCSS compilation errors
↓
Spent 6+ hours debugging
↓
Switched to Netlify
↓
Deployed successfully in 10 minutes ✅
Understanding the Workflow:
Both approaches require GitHub for code hosting, but differ in deployment:
Your Code (Local)
↓
GitHub Repository (Required for both)
↓
┌─────────────────┬─────────────────┐
│ │ │
GitHub Pages OR Netlify
(Direct deploy) (Better build system)
↓ ↓
Your Website Your Website
yourname.github.io yourname.netlify.app
Why Netlify Works Better:
- Same GitHub account needed - Your code still lives on GitHub
- Official Hugo Blox recommendation - Tested and supported
- Automatic dependency handling - Solves TailwindCSS issues
- Zero configuration needed - Just connect and deploy
- Free tier sufficient - Perfect for academic sites
- Continuous deployment - Auto-updates when you push to GitHub
Key Point: You’ll still use GitHub to store and manage your code. Netlify simply reads from your GitHub repository and builds your website with better tools.
3. Step-by-Step Setup
Phase 1: Prerequisites
# Install Hugo (macOS with Homebrew)
brew install hugo
# Verify installation
hugo version # Should be >= 0.148.0
Phase 2: Local Setup
# Clone the official template
git clone https://github.com/HugoBlox/theme-academic-cv.git my-academic-site
cd my-academic-site
# Remove template git history
rm -rf .git
# Initialize your own repository
git init
git branch -M main
# Connect to your GitHub repository
git remote add origin https://github.com/YourUsername/YourUsername.github.io.git
# First commit
git add .
git commit -m "Initial commit: Hugo Academic site"
git push -u origin main
Phase 3: Basic Configuration
Edit config/_default/hugo.yaml:
title: 'Your Name, PhD'
baseURL: 'https://yourname.netlify.app/'
Edit content/authors/admin/_index.md with your information.
Phase 4: Deploy to Netlify
Step 1: Sign up at netlify.com using GitHub
Step 2: Import your repository
Step 3: Configure build settings:
- Branch:
main - Build command:
hugo --gc --minify - Publish directory:
public
Step 4: Add environment variables:
HUGO_VERSION = 0.152.1
NODE_VERSION = 20
Step 5: Deploy! Your site will be live at https://random-name.netlify.app
Step 6: Customize your URL in Site Settings → Domain Management
4. Common Issues & Solutions
Issue 1: TailwindCSS Error
Error Message:
Error: TAILWINDCSS: failed to transform
binary with name "tailwindcss" not found
Solution:
# If error occurs locally, simply ignore it
# Push to Netlify - it will work there
git push origin main
# Or install dependencies locally
npm install
Issue 2: Content Not Updating
Cause: Changes not pushed to GitHub
Solution:
git status
git add .
git commit -m "Update content"
git push origin main
# Wait 2-3 minutes for Netlify to redeploy

Issue 4: Content Folder Ignored by Git
Symptoms:
- Local
hugo serverdisplays pages correctly ✅ - Netlify deployment shows “Page Not Found” ❌
git statusshows “nothing to commit, working tree clean”- You know the files exist locally
Root Cause:
Your content folder name matches a pattern in .gitignore, causing Git to ignore it entirely.
Example:
# .gitignore contains
resources/
# Your content structure
content/
└── resources/ # ❌ Accidentally ignored!
└── hugo-guide/
└── _index.md
Diagnosis:
# Check if files are being ignored
git status --ignored
# Check specific file
git check-ignore -v content/resources/_index.md
# Output: .gitignore:10:resources/ content/resources/_index.md
Solution Options:
Option 1: Rename the folder (Simplest) ✅ Recommended
# Rename to avoid the pattern
git mv content/resources content/resource
# or
git mv content/resources content/guides
# Update your menus.yaml accordingly
url: '/resource/hugo-guide/' # Updated path
# Commit and push
git add .
git commit -m "Rename folder to avoid .gitignore conflict"
git push origin main
Option 2: Make .gitignore more specific
# Edit .gitignore
# Change: resources/
# To: /resources/ # Only ignores root-level resources/
# Force add the previously ignored files
git add -f content/resources/
# Commit and push
git commit -m "Fix: Update .gitignore and add content/resources"
git push origin main
Option 3: Add exception to .gitignore
# Add to .gitignore
resources/ # Ignore Hugo's resources
!content/resources/ # But allow content/resources
# Force add
git add -f content/resources/
git commit -m "Add content/resources with .gitignore exception"
git push origin main
Prevention Tips:
Check common .gitignore patterns before naming folders:
- Avoid:
resources/,public/,static/,node_modules/ - Safe:
guides/,tutorials/,docs/,posts/
- Avoid:
Verify files are tracked:
# After creating new content folders git status # Should show new files, not emptyUse descriptive, unique names:
✅ content/research-guides/ ✅ content/tutorials/ ✅ content/documentation/ ❌ content/resources/ (conflicts with Hugo's resources/)
5. ⚠️ CRITICAL: Backup Strategy
This section might save you hours of frustration.
The Problem
During development, you might accidentally:
- Overwrite files with
git reset --hard - Lose content during merge conflicts
- Delete files unintentionally
Without backups, your content is gone.
The Solution: Multiple Backup Layers
Layer 1: Local Folder Backups 💾
THIS IS THE MOST IMPORTANT❗
After every significant editing session, backup your entire project folder:
# Basic backup command (recommended)
cp -r my-academic-site my-academic-site-backup-$(date +%Y%m%d-%H%M)
# If you get "Permission denied" error, use rsync:
rsync -av --exclude='.git' my-academic-site/ my-academic-site-backup-$(date +%Y%m%d-%H%M)/
Why this matters:
- Most direct and reliable backup method
- Complete snapshot independent of Git
- Takes 10 seconds, can save hours of work
- Easy to browse and restore
Recommended Backup Schedule:
- ✅ After each major content addition
- ✅ Before any risky Git operations
- ✅ At the end of each editing session
- ✅ Before updating Hugo or dependencies
Where to store backups:
# Create a dedicated backup folder
mkdir -p ~/Desktop/website-backups
# Backup there
cp -r my-academic-site ~/Desktop/website-backups/backup-$(date +%Y%m%d-%H%M)
Layer 2: Git Commits 📦
Commit frequently:
# After editing 1-3 files
git add .
git commit -m "Update: specific description"
git push origin main
Benefits:
- Version history tracking
- Can roll back to any point
- Automatically synced to GitHub
Layer 3: Backup Branches 🌿
Create periodic backup branches before major changes:
# Weekly backup
git branch backup-weekly-$(date +%Y%m%d)
git push origin backup-weekly-$(date +%Y%m%d)
# Before major redesign
git branch backup-before-redesign
git push origin backup-before-redesign
Layer 4: AI Conversation Archives 🤖
When everything else fails, AI conversations can be a lifesaver.
If you’re using AI assistance extensively:
Create milestone snapshots:
- When you complete a major phase (e.g., “Initial setup complete”)
- Start a new conversation with: “This is a backup conversation for [date]”
- Paste your complete current working version
- Store outside your project folder to avoid accidental deletion
Why this works:
- AI chat history persists even if local files are lost
- Can reconstruct your project from conversation history
- Documents your decision-making process
- Useful reference when similar issues arise
Pro Tip: Don’t save every small code snippet. Instead, create comprehensive milestone backups when you reach stable states.
Backup Workflow Summary
# === Daily Workflow ===
# 1. Start editing
cd ~/my-academic-site
# 2. Make changes to content
# 3. Test locally (optional)
hugo server -D
# 4. Local backup (PRIORITY #1 - DO NOT SKIP!)
cp -r ~/my-academic-site ~/Desktop/website-backups/backup-$(date +%Y%m%d-%H%M)
# 5. Git commit (PRIORITY #2)
git add .
git commit -m "Update: what you changed"
git push origin main
# 6. Verify deployment on Netlify
# 7. (Optional) Create backup branch before major changes
git branch backup-before-major-change
git push origin backup-before-major-change
# 8. (Milestone) Archive complete version in AI conversation if needed
Remember: Backups are cheap, recreating lost work is expensive. Local backups are your first and most reliable safety net.
